TITLE: The Puzzle of the Paper Daughter

AUTHOR: Kathryn Reiss

COPYRIGHT: 2010

ORIGINAL PUBLISHER: American Girl Publishing, Inc.

NUMBER OF PAGES: 173

PLOTLINE: Julie Albright finds a paper in an old red jacket that has a lot of Chinese writing on it. She takes it to her best friend, Ivy Ling, whose Chinese teacher can help her translate the message.

The paper leads to the discovery of a woman named Mei Meng, who used to be Ivy’s grandmother’s friend. What’s more, Julie and Ivy believe that Mei still has a doll that might contain a valuable jade necklace.

But someone is on Julie’s trail, trying to find out about the treasure himself . . . and that someone may just find the necklace first! Can Julie and Ivy untangle the many clues to the mystery before things get dangerous?
